Minn. Stat. § 147F.15

LICENSED GENETIC COUNSELOR ADVISORY COUNCIL.

2016 c 189 art 21 s 8

Subdivision 1. Membership.

The board shall appoint a five-member Licensed Genetic Counselor Advisory Council. One member must be a licensed physician with experience in genetics, three members must be licensed genetic counselors, and one member must be a public member.

Subd. 2. Organization.

The advisory council shall be organized and administered as provided in section 15.059 .

Subd. 3. Duties.

The advisory council shall:

(1) advise the board regarding standards for licensed genetic counselors;

(2) provide for distribution of information regarding licensed genetic counselor practice standards;

(3) advise the board on enforcement of this chapter;

(4) review applications and recommend granting or denying licensure or license renewal;

(5) advise the board on issues related to receiving and investigating complaints, conducting hearings, and imposing disciplinary action in relation to complaints against licensed genetic counselors; and

(6) perform other duties authorized for advisory councils under chapter 214, as directed by the board.

Subd. 4. Expiration.

Notwithstanding section 15.059 , the advisory council does not expire.
